JMPA Reveals Manga Magazine Circulation Numbers for January to March 2019

posted on by Crystalyn Hodgkins
Weekly Shonen Jump drops below 1.7 million, Weekly Shōnen Magazine drops to 715,000

The Japan Magazine Publishers Association (JMPA) revealed on Tuesday the circulation numbers for January through March of most major manga magazines.

Monthly Shonen Sirius (pictured at right) was the only magazine that saw an increase in circulation numbers compared to the previous quarter. Several other magazines kept the same circulation or close to the same circulation.

For comparison, the charts below also feature circulation numbers for the same magazines for October through December 2018.

Magazines for Boys

Magazine Publisher Circulation Jan.-Mar. 2019 Circulation Oct.-Dec. 2018
Monthly Shonen Magazine Kodansha 299,567 324,000
Weekly Shōnen Magazine Kodansha 715,417 744,583
Monthly Shonen Sirius Kodansha 14,867 9,700
Ultra Jump Shueisha 30,667 33,667
Weekly Shonen Jump Shueisha 1,692,000 1,706,923
Monthly Coro Coro Comics Shogakukan 623,333 663,333
Monthly Sunday GX Shogakukan 7,500 8,333
Weekly Shonen Sunday Shogakukan 277,500 296,250
Shōnen Sunday S Shogakukan 24,000 27,333
Bessatsu Coro Coro Comics Special Shogakukan 65,000 75,000
Jump SQ. Shueisha 172,000 175,000
Monthly Shonen Sunday (Gessan) Shogakukan 21,000 22,000
Coro Coro Ichiban! Shogakukan 58,333 66,667
Bessatsu Shōnen Magazine Kodansha 54,333 57,333


Magazines for Men

Magazine Publisher Circulation Jan.-Mar. 2019 Circulation Oct.-Dec. 2018
Afternoon Kodansha 49,000 51,000
Evening Kodansha 75,000 76,133
Morning Kodansha 171,300 174,867
Young Magazine Kodansha 325,733 337,500
Weekly Young Jump Shueisha 467,209 485,538
Big Comic Shogakukan 271,000 275,333
Big Comic Original Shogakukan 465,833 471,667
Big Comic Spirits Shogakukan 129,167 134,500
Big Comic Superior Shogakukan 98,667 101,000
Young Animal Hakusensha 87,167 91,500
Comi Ran Twins LEED Publishing 111,720 112,110
Comic Ran LEED Publishing 179,537 182,833
Morning two Kodansha 11,600 12,000
Grand Jump Shueisha 165,783 167,000
Monthly! Spirits Shogakukan 7,000 7,000


Magazines for Girls

Magazine Publisher Circulation Jan.-Mar. 2019 Circulation Oct.-Dec. 2018
Nakayoshi Kodansha 77,700 80,875
Bessatsu Friend Kodansha 54,000 60,167
The Margaret Shueisha 26,000 33,000
Bessatsu Margaret Shueisha 113,333 120,000
Margaret Shueisha 32,800 35,083
Ribon Shueisha 140,000 141,250
Sho-Comi Shogakukan 70,000 76,667
Cheese! Shogakukan 30,333 33,667
Ciao Shogakukan 365,000 365,000
Betsucomi Shogakukan 23,000 25,333
Hana to Yume Hakusensha 109,167 110,917
LaLa Hakusensha 104,333 105,000
LaLa DX Hakusensha 39,000 40,000


Magazines for Women

Magazine Publisher Circulation Jan.-Mar. 2019 Circulation Oct.-Dec. 2018
Kiss Kodansha 60,733 62,000
Dessert Kodansha 38,333 41,000
Be Love Kodansha 73,000 73,051
office YOU Shueisha 47,000 49,667
Cookie Shueisha 30,000 31,000
Petit Comic Shogakukan 66,667 68,333
Flowers Shogakukan 31,667 33,000
Feel Young Shodensha 9,067 9,533
Melody Hakusensha 35,000 36,250
Cocohana Shueisha 54,233 54,300


In April, Shueisha revealed average circulation numbers and demographic information for its magazines for 2018.

Weekly Shonen Jump's circulation dipped below two million on average during the January to March 2017 period. Similarly, Weekly Shōnen Magazine's circulation dipped below one million during the July-September 2016 time period.
